Ronald PRYCE Obituary

Passed away on Saturday, 22nd November 2025, aged 83 years. Dearly loved husband of Raylee for 61 Years. Much loved father and father-in-law of Sefton and partner Christine, and Gareth and Jacqueline. Our grateful thanks to the staff of the SCU at Jean Sandel for their exceptional care of Ron these past four months. Messages may be left online at wabraham.co.nz/notices or posted to the Pryce family, C/- PO Box 4016, New Plymouth 4340. In accordance with Ron's wishes, a private cremation has been held.


Published by Taranaki Daily News on Nov. 29, 2025.
